- Title
Possible cardioprotective role of NaHS on ECG and oxidative stress markers in an unpredictable chronic mild stress model in rats.
- Authors
Ghalwash, Mohammad; Elmasry, Ahlam; Omar, Nisreen Mansour Abo-elmaaty
- Abstract
The article reports on the possible cardioprotective role of sodium hydrosulfide (NaHS) on electrocardiogram (ECG) and oxidative stress markers on unpredictable chronic mild stress models in rats. Topics include the potential role of NaHS as hydrogen sulfide (H2S) donor in chronic mild stress in rats and the use of adult male Sprague Dawley rats in the study.
